Tyrone Eastern led the scoring for the Pirates running a pair of 7-yarders into the end zone and Pattonville remained undefeated after a 37-14 win against Lindbergh on Aug. 29 at Pattonville Stadium.
Pirate Pride hosted a tailgate with a neon theme, and the football players were the ones shining bright on the field.
Freshman quarterback Kaleb Eleby tossed two touchdowns through the air. A 63-yard connection to Anthony Green in the second quarter put Pattonville ahead of Lindbergh 20-14 and the Pirate defense shut the Flyers out for the rest of the game.
The defense totaled three interceptions on the night including an 18-yard pick that CJ McDaniel took back for a score in the first half.
For the final two plays of the game, head coach Steve Smith may have listened to the voices coming from the student section in the bleachers.
“We want Big Dawg, we want Big Dawg!”
Justin “Big Dawg” Vaughn entered the game for a running play and then for the victory formation.
After the game, Vaughn was being treated as one of the stars of the game taking pictures with students and passing out high-fives like he scored the winning touchdown.
And for those wondering if he heard the crowd.
“Oh yea, it was awesome,” Vaughn said.
Pattonville plays at Hazelwood West next week.
